Output 24c5d6303d3172959f291604955e7c1f3869534b3efea1ccb94b0fc7eadf546a:73

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3c5a8329746295f97326715807012906b8a3fd50ec363c45bacb6556a5a89a06
address
bc1p83dgx2t5v22ljuexw9vqwqffq6u28l2sasmrc3d6edj4dfdgngrqlcdzlx
transaction
24c5d6303d3172959f291604955e7c1f3869534b3efea1ccb94b0fc7eadf546a
spent
true